Atheism, of course, has a long history. The psalmist declared in Ps. 14:1 and
53:1 that the fool says in his heart "There is no God." Some ancient Greek and Roman
philosophers were essentially atheists because they thought that any deities that existed were uninterested in and thus irrelevant to human existence. For example, the Greek philosopher Epicurus (4th-3rd centuries B.C.) and the Roman philosopher Lucretius (1st century B.C.) thought that matter was all there is and that when you die that's the end of it.
